What makes the Frizz Rebel oil blend effective at taming frizz?
The Frizz Rebel oil blend works because coconut oil nourishes and helps seal the cuticle, while sweet almond oil adds light moisture and shine without heaviness. Together, they reduce frizz, protect against moisture loss, and support smoother, softer hair. This combination is available in products like the Frizz Rebel Growth Oil and the Frizz Rebel Coconut & Sweet Almond Oil from Aunt Jackie's line. Choose it if you want a lightweight, daily-use oil to apply to damp or dry hair.

How do I apply and maintain Aunt Jackie's frizz-focused products to avoid buildup?
Patch test any new Aunt Jackie's product before full use. Apply Frizz Rebel Growth Oil to damp or dry hair, focusing on the mid-lengths and ends; use a small amount to avoid heaviness. For Curl La La Defining Curl Custard, start with a pea-sized amount and distribute through damp curls for definition and frizz control. If you notice buildup, clarify your hair and adjust how often you use the products, then store them in a cool, dry place.
